Change Sharepoint 2016 roles from custom to frontend

Deleted
Not applicable

I have planned an installation of  a new SP farm, however the customer has only one server available, its a farm for 400 users and maximum 40 users concurrently, so I think with a minrole (custom) it will be enough.

 

However after a few months we have the requirement to migrate a network drive with about 1TB of information, so we will create a document management portal for that with content types, libraries, subsites, etc.

 

At that time we wil surely need additional servers, lets say minimum one additional server with the search minrole.

 

Questions are:

1. Can I change  a server from role custom to Front end? what about if I started search services there? then what would I need to do?

2. The farm wil hold many documents, however the concurrent users are not too many, any recommended nr of servers for 1TB of information so we have a fresh crawl and fast queries?

 

 Number of files 600,000

 

Thanks

1 Reply
1) Yes, via Central Admin -> System Settings. Juts "fix" the role if it flags the server. It's a one-click operation.
2) I usually recommend 4 servers, 2 DC+FE, 2 App+Search. Might be overkill, but it's a good place to start due to high availability of the solution. Just don't schedule any full crawls; use Continuous Crawl.